Environmental Impact Analysis



Solar energy presents an appealing choice to conventional energy sources as a result of its substantially lower ecological influence. Unlike nonrenewable fuel sources that emit damaging greenhouse gases and add to air pollution, solar energy generates electricity without generating any kind of discharges.

The procedure of taking advantage of solar power includes catching sunshine via solar panels, which doesn't release any kind of toxins right into the ambience. This lack of emissions helps in reducing the carbon footprint associated with energy manufacturing, making solar power a cleaner and a lot more sustainable choice.

Furthermore, using solar energy adds to preservation initiatives by reducing the demand for finite resources like coal, oil, and natural gas. By relying upon the sunlight's plentiful and renewable resource resource, we can help protect natural environments, protect environments, and alleviate the adverse impacts of source extraction.

Reliability and Energy Landscape Analysis



For a detailed evaluation of reliability and the power landscape, it's essential to evaluate how solar power contrasts to conventional resources. Solar energy is pushing on as a trusted and lasting power resource. While traditional sources like coal, oil, and natural gas have been traditionally dominant, they're finite and contribute to environmental deterioration.

Solar power, on the other hand, is plentiful and sustainable, making it a much more lasting alternative over time.

In terms of dependability, solar power can be depending on weather conditions and sunlight schedule. However, improvements in innovation have brought about the development of power storage options like batteries, boosting the integrity of solar energy systems. Traditional resources, on the other hand, are prone to rate fluctuations, geopolitical tensions, and supply chain disturbances, making them much less reliable in the long-term.

When assessing the energy landscape, solar power uses decentralized energy production, lowering transmission losses and increasing energy security. Typical sources, with their centralized nuclear power plant, are much more at risk to disruptions and need comprehensive framework for circulation.
